I watched wrestling as a kid and went to one of the last UK shows WCW did, but I'd totally lost interest by 2003 and never really thought about it again. Cut to late 2016 and I see some online friends talking about how good Smackdown has been, I'm curious so I check it out and I'm instantly hooked and staying up late watching ppvs regularly. Then in January 2018 I went to a British wrestling show and saw Will Ospreay in a match, blew my mind and turned me on to New Japan. Since then I've abandoned WWE, tried almost every wrestling streaming service going and watched hundreds of matches that for a time I was keeping well organised ranked spreadsheets for. I guess I wouldn't count as a new fan because I liked it as a kid, but I think getting people who watched as a kid to start taking it seriously is very much possible. You just need word of mouth about quality wrestling and booking, going to live shows really gets across how powerful a wrestling match can be.
